Director of Business Development

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Director of Business Development in United States.

This role is focused on driving strategic growth across the western United States and select regions of Canada within the professional beauty industry. You will work closely with distributor partners, field sales teams, salons, and internal stakeholders to strengthen brand presence and accelerate commercial performance. Acting as both a strategic partner and hands-on business driver, you will identify growth opportunities, support salon expansion, and help execute regional initiatives. The position requires a strong blend of relationship-building, commercial insight, and operational execution. You will operate in a fast-paced, collaborative environment where autonomy, ownership, and proactive thinking are essential. This is a high-impact role for someone passionate about building brands and scaling business through strong partnerships.

Accountabilities

In this role, you will be responsible for supporting and driving business development initiatives across assigned territories through distributor and salon partnerships. You will play a key role in expanding brand presence, improving performance, and enabling long-term regional growth.

  • Support business development strategies across the western U.S. and select Canadian regions through distributor networks
  • Partner with distributor leadership and field sales teams to drive salon growth and commercial performance
  • Identify and pursue opportunities to increase brand visibility and market penetration within existing territories
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with distributor partners, salon owners, and field sales representatives
  • Collaborate with internal teams including sales, education, marketing, and operations to align execution and strategy
  • Analyze regional performance data, market trends, and competitive activity to support business planning
  • Support strategic salon partnerships, key account development, and regional expansion initiatives
  • Represent the organization at industry events, distributor meetings, education sessions, and salon visits
  • Support execution of product launches, promotional campaigns, and regional initiatives
  • Maintain consistent communication with external partners to ensure alignment and execution of business objectives
Requirements

The ideal candidate brings strong experience in business development or field leadership within the professional beauty or salon industry, along with a proven ability to grow business through distributor relationships.

  • 5+ years of experience in business development, sales leadership, account management, or field leadership within the professional beauty industry
  • Strong understanding of salon distribution models and the professional beauty ecosystem
  • Proven track record of driving business growth through distributor and partner relationships
  • Excellent communication, presentation, and relationship-building skills
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ities with a data-informed mindset
  • Ability to work independently while collaborating effectively across teams and partners
  • Entrepreneurial mindset with strong ownership and execution capability
  • Experience working closely with distributor sales teams and salon partners preferred
  • Willingness and ability to travel frequently (approximately 50% or more) across the territory
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
